Subject: [Buildroot] Dangling symbolic links in the generated toolchain
Date: Thu, 13 Mar 2008 14:52:59 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20080313145259.0af99b35@crazy> (raw)

Hi,

When creating a toolchain with the attached config file, there are some
dangling symlinks in build_arm/staging_dir/ :

$ symlinks -r build_arm/staging_dir/ | grep ^dangling
dangling: build_arm/staging_dir/arm-linux -> arm-linux-uclibcgnueabi
dangling: build_arm/staging_dir/usr/bin/cc -> gcc

The former should probably point to usr/arm-linux-uclibcgnueabi
instead. No idea for the latter, though.
